Intrepid Close is in Seaton Carew, Hartlepool and in Hartlepool district. TS25 1GE is located in the Seaton elect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Hartlepool. This postcode has been in use since 2000-06-01.

Is Intrepid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Intrepid Close was 485.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 50.2% higher than the Burn Valley average. The most reported crime type was Shoplifting.

Intrepid Close has the 18th highest crime rate of 90 local areas in Burn Valley and the 25th highest crime rate of 320 local areas in Hartlepool .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 124.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 29.1%.

Employment

TS25 1GE area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
